什么编程能在手机软件
-
手机软件开发领域有许多编程语言可以使用。以下是一些常见的编程语言,可以用于开发手机软件:
-
Java:Java是最常用的编程语言之一,特别适合Android平台上的手机软件开发。通过使用Java编程语言和Android开发工具包(Android SDK),开发者可以创建功能强大的Android应用程序。
-
Swift:Swift是苹果公司开发的一种编程语言,适用于iOS和macOS平台上的手机软件开发。Swift语言具有简洁、安全、高效的特点,使开发者能够更快速地构建出色的应用程序。
-
Kotlin:Kotlin是一种由JetBrains开发的现代编程语言,也可用于Android应用程序开发。Kotlin语言与Java语言兼容,并且提供了更多的功能和语法糖,使得开发过程更加简洁和高效。
-
C++:C++是一种通用的编程语言,也被广泛用于手机软件开发。使用C++语言可以编写高性能的应用程序,尤其适合需要处理大量数据和图形渲染的应用。
-
HTML/CSS/JavaScript:这些是用于开发移动Web应用程序的基本技术。通过使用HTML(超文本标记语言)、CSS(层叠样式表)和JavaScript,开发者可以创建跨平台的移动应用程序,并在多个设备上运行。
除了以上列举的语言,还有其他编程语言可以用于手机软件开发,如C#(用于Windows Phone应用程序开发)、Python、Ruby等。选择适合的编程语言取决于开发者的需求、目标平台和个人偏好。
1年前 -
-
手机软件开发可以使用多种编程语言和技术。以下是一些常用的编程语言和技术,可以用于开发手机软件:
-
Java:Java是一种通用的编程语言,也是Android手机软件开发的主要语言。它具有广泛的社区支持和丰富的开发工具,可以用于开发各种类型的应用程序。
-
Kotlin:Kotlin是一种现代化的编程语言,也是Android开发的一种选择。它与Java兼容,具有更简洁的语法和更多的功能。Kotlin在近年来在Android开发领域越来越受欢迎。
-
Swift:Swift是苹果公司开发的一种编程语言,用于开发iOS手机软件。它具有简洁的语法和强大的功能,可以帮助开发者更快速地构建高性能的iOS应用程序。
-
React Native:React Native是一种基于JavaScript的开发框架,可以用于同时开发Android和iOS应用程序。它使用了一种称为"原生组件"的机制,可以让开发者使用JavaScript编写应用程序的核心逻辑,并在每个平台上渲染原生用户界面。
-
Flutter:Flutter是谷歌开发的一种跨平台开发框架,可以用于同时开发Android和iOS应用程序。它使用一种称为Dart的编程语言,并提供了丰富的UI组件和工具,可以实现快速的应用程序开发和良好的性能。
总结起来,手机软件开发可以使用多种编程语言和技术,包括Java、Kotlin、Swift、React Native和Flutter等。开发者可以根据自己的需求和技能选择适合的编程语言和技术来开发手机软件。
1年前 -
-
手机软件的编程主要分为两个方面,一是手机应用开发,二是手机游戏开发。
一、手机应用开发
-
Java:Java是目前最常用的手机应用开发语言,使用Java开发的应用可以在Android系统上运行。开发者可以使用Java开发工具包(JDK)和Android开发工具包(ADK)来编写和调试Android应用。
-
Swift/Objective-C:Swift和Objective-C是苹果公司的iOS系统上常用的开发语言。Objective-C是一种较早的iOS开发语言,而Swift是苹果公司在2014年推出的新一代编程语言。开发者可以使用Xcode开发工具来编写和调试iOS应用。
-
C#:C#是微软公司的开发语言,开发者可以使用C#和.NET框架来编写Windows Phone应用。Visual Studio是C#开发的主要工具。
-
HTML5/CSS/JavaScript:使用HTML5、CSS和JavaScript可以开发跨平台的移动应用。开发者可以使用框架如PhoneGap、React Native等来开发一次编写,多平台运行的应用。
二、手机游戏开发
-
Unity3D:Unity3D是一款跨平台的游戏引擎,可以用于开发Android和iOS上的游戏。Unity3D支持C#和JavaScript两种编程语言,开发者可以使用Unity编辑器来创建游戏场景、添加游戏逻辑等。
-
Cocos2d-x:Cocos2d-x是一个开源的跨平台游戏引擎,支持使用C++和Lua编写游戏。开发者可以使用Cocos2d-x编辑器来创建游戏场景、处理用户输入等。
-
Unreal Engine:Unreal Engine是一款强大的游戏引擎,支持多平台开发,包括Android和iOS。Unreal Engine使用C++编程语言,开发者可以使用Unreal Editor来创建游戏场景、设置游戏逻辑等。
以上是手机软件开发中常用的编程语言和工具,开发者可以根据自己的需求和技术能力选择适合的编程方式来开发手机应用或游戏。
1年前 -